NCS36000
Passive Infrared (PIR)
Detector Controller
The NCS36000 is a fully integrated mixed−signal CMOS device
designed for low−cost passive infrared controlling applications. The
device integrates two low−noise amplifiers and a LDO regulator to
drive the sensor. The output of the amplifiers goes to a window
comparator that uses internal voltage references from the regulator.
The digital control circuit processes the output from the window
comparator and provides the output to the OUT and LED pin.
Features
• 3.0 − 5.75 V Operation
• −40 to 85°C
• 14 Pin SOIC Package
• Integrated 2−Stage Amplifier
• Internal LDO to Drive Sensor
• Internal Oscillator with External RC
• Single or Dual Pulse Detection
• Direct Drive of LED and OUT
• This is a Pb−Free Device
Typical Applications
• Automatic Lighting (Residential and Commercial)
• Automation of Doors
• Motion Triggered Events (Animal photography)
